抄録

In the field of sericulture, rapid and rigorous determinations of insecticide residue is an important problem to prevent the pesticide injury to silkworm larvae. In the present research, quantitative infrared analyses of residues of pp'-DDT, γ-BHC, dieldrin and parathion, and their formulations on mulberry leaves were carried out with the use of the potassium bromide disk method in infrared spectrophotometry.<br>The standard curves of these chemicals were made at first using the potassium bromide disk method, and then recovery tests were made with both purified agents and commercial formulations, which were sprayed on mulberry leaves. Out of the spectral characteristics of each agents, three absorption bands were employed as a key band group; i.e. 955, 913 and 782cm-1 of infrared spectra of γ-BHC, 1085, 1005 and 770cm-1 of pp'-DDT, 1178, 1042 and 848cm-1 of dieldrin and 1355, 1035 and 925cm-1 of methylparathion and ethylparathion. Separation of insecticide residues from mulberry leaves was made by double extraction with n-hexane-acetonitril, followed by cleanup procedure with an alumina column.<br>Results of recovery experiments were shown in Table 1. The recovery rate was 70∼80% for γ-BHC and dieldrin and 94∼95% for methylparathion. No interference in determinations was noticed with the existence of an emulsifier in commercially formulated products, except in the BHC emulsion. Even in the BHC emulsion, absorption band due to emulsifier appeared in the 1200∼1000cm-1 range, so that determinations were succesfully made, employing the key band group of 955, 913 and 782cm-1.<br>The determination of the absorption ratio was possible as low as 0.01∼0.015% (20∼30μg/200mg KBr). The time required for the whole procedure, including separation and cleanup of insecticide redidues was one to two hours.
